JSN-SR20-Y1 çift problu menzil modülü, 2cm-500cm temassız mesafe algılama işlevi sağlayabilir ve menzil doğruluğu 3 mm'ye kadar çıkabilir; Modül, bir alıcı-verici entegre ultrasonik sensör ve bir kontrol devresi içerir.Birinci modun kullanımı HC-SR04 modülümüze benzer.
Bu ürün, piyasadaki tüm mcu'larla çalışmak için endüstriyel sınıf çift su geçirmez ultrasonik prob tasarımı, su geçirmez tip, istikrarlı performans ve alçakgönüllülüğü benimser.
Süper yakın mesafe, kör bölge sadece 2 cm'dir.Kararlı menzil, bu ürünün pazara başarılı bir şekilde girmesi için güçlü bir temeldir.
Özellikler:
1. Küçük boyutu ve kullanımı rahat;
2. Ultra küçük kör alan ölçümü.
3. Yüksek ölçüm doğruluğu;
4. Güçlü anti-parazit;
5. Islak ve sert ölçüm durumları için uygun entegre kapalı su geçirmez bant probu
Teknik özellikler ve parametreler :
darbe çıkışı
seri çıkış
çalışma gerilimi
DC:3.0-5.5 V
çalışma akımı
Daha az8ma
prob frekansı
40kHz
en uzak menzil
500cm
son menzil
2cm
uzun mesafeli doğruluk
± 1cm
çözünme
3mm
açıyı ölçmek için
60 derece
giriş tetik sinyali
1,20 Usyukarıdaki itme
2ve talimatları göndermek için seri port0x55
yankı sinyalinin çıkışı
çıkış darbe genişliği seviyesi sinyali, orTTL
bağlantı modu
3-5. 5 V (pozitif kutup)
Trigonometri (kontrol terminali)RX
Yankı (Çıkış)TX
GND (Güç kaynağının negatif kutbu
ürün boyutu
L48 * G23 * Y10 mm
çalışma sıcaklığı
-20℃-+ 70℃
parça rengi
PCBboard mavi
hat probu ile: Standart hat uzunluğu 1 metredir
mod 0: Moode = açık, kaynak yok.Mod aşağıdaki gibidir
1, temel çalışma prensibi:
(1) menzili tetiklemek için IO portu trigonometrisini kullanın ve minimum 20US ile yüksek güç seviyesi sinyalleri sunun.
(2)modül, bir sinyal dönüşü olup olmadığını otomatik olarak algılamak için otomatik olarak 40 khz'lik 8 kare dalga gönderir;
(3) bir sinyal varsa, ECHO IO portu üzerinden yüksek bir seviye çıkarır.Yüksek seviyenin süresi, ultrasonik dalganın gönderilmesinden geri döndüğü zamandır.Test mesafesi = (yüksek seviye Zaman * ses hızı (348M / S)) / 2;
(4) modül mesafe ölçümü için tetiklendikten sonra, yankı alınmazsa (neden ölçülen aralığın ötesindedir veya prob ölçülen nesneye bakmaz), YANKI Portu 40 ms sonra otomatik olarak düşecektir, bu ölçümün sonunu işaretler, başarılı olsun ya da olmasın.
2Ultrasonik zamanlama diyagramı:
şekil II, ultrasonik zamanlama
12: Mod = 47KUARTautomatik çıkış
Uartotomatik çıkış modu, UART iletişim formatına göre mesafe değerini (onaltılık sayı) çıkarır.Bu modun ek tetikleme sinyaline ihtiyacı yoktur ve modül her 100 ms'de bir otomatik olarak ölçüm yapabilir, mesafe değerini ölçmek için TX pin çıkışında her ölçüm tamamlanır.
(1) pın tanımı
seri Numarası
çimento sınıfı
pın açıklaması
not
2
TX
Uartçıkış pimleri
3
RX
hayır
(2) iletişim protokolü
UART'IN
baud hızı
bitleri kontrol et
veri bitleri
durmak
TTL
9600 bps
N
8
1
(3) Biçim Açıklaması
çerçeve verileri
tanım
bayt
çerçeve başlığı
DÜZELTİLMİŞ0XFF
1 bayt
H_DATA
high8bit'in mesafe verileri
1 bayt
L_VERİ
low8bit mesafe verileri
1 bayt
TOPLAM
veri doğrulama
1 bayt
not: sağlama toplamı yalnızca kümülatif değerin düşük 8 bitini korur
örneğin:
ürün yanıtı FF 07 A1 A7
burada kontrol kodu TOPLAMI =A7 = (0x07 0x1 0Xff) ve 0x00ff
0x07yüksek mesafe verileri;
Mesafe için 0xA1low verileri;
mesafe değeri 0 x07a1'dir; Ondalık sayıya dönüştürülen 1953'tür; Birim: MM
not: Modül verileri ölçemezse veya mesafe aralığının ötesinde 0 çıkarırsa.Led açıldıktan sonra çalışma moduna girer ve otomatik olarak 100 ms yanıp söner.
mode2: Mod=120kuartrollü çıkış
Uartkontrollü çıkış modu, UART iletişim formatına göre ölçülen mesafe değerini (onaltılık sayı) verir.Bu modun RX ayağına 0x55 tetik sinyali eklemesi gerekir ve modül her talimat aldığında ölçer, mesafe değerini ölçmek için TX pin çıkışında her ölçüm tamamlanır.Talimat tetikleme döngüsü 60 ms'den büyüktür
(1) pın tanımı
seri Numarası
çimento sınıfı
pın açıklaması
not
2
TX
Uartçıkış pimleri
3
RX
Bir ayak almak için kontrol edildi
(Komut 0X55)
(2) iletişim protokolü
UART'IN
baud hızı
bitleri kontrol et
veri bitleri
durmak
TTL
9600 bps
N
8
1
(3) Biçim Açıklaması
çerçeve verileri
tanım
bayt
çerçeve başlığı
DÜZELTİLMİŞ0XFF
1 bayt
H_DATA
high8bit'in mesafe verileri
1 bayt
L_VERİ
low8bit mesafe verileri
1 bayt
TOPLAM
veri doğrulama
1 bayt
not: sağlama toplamı yalnızca kümülatif değerin düşük 8 bitini korur
örneğin:
ürün yanıtı FF 07 A1 A7
burada kontrol kodu TOPLAMI =A7 = (0x07 0x1 0Xff) ve 0x00ff
0x07yüksek mesafe verileri;
Mesafe için 0xA1low verileri;
mesafe değeri 0 x07a1'dir; Ondalık sayıya dönüştürülen 1953'tür; Birim: MM
not: Modül verileri ölçemezse veya mesafe aralığının ötesinde 0 çıkarırsa.Led açıldıktan sonra, her tetiklendiğinde komut ışığı yanacaktır.Frekans, tetikleme döngüsü ile aynıdır.
mode3: Mod = 200 Khz Yüksek seviye (PWM) darbe genişliği otomatik çıkış
darbe genişliğipwmotomatik çıkışlı modül, 200 ms aralıklarla otomatik olarak ölçüm yapar ve testten sonraki mesafeye karşılık gelen yüksek darbe genişliği seviyesini verir.Hesaplama mesafesi modu referans modu 1